Junior Dispatcher

**Duties**:

- Clear goods through customs and to their destinations for clients.
- Coordinate with third-party logistics providers (3PL) to ensure timely and efficient delivery of goods
- Manage fleet operations and schedule drivers for pick-up and deliveries.
- Communicate with shipping and receiving departments to ensure accurate and timely movement of goods.
- Perform data entry tasks to update shipment information in the system.
- Answer phone calls and respond to inquiries from drivers, customers, and other stakeholders.
- Monitor and maintain communication systems, including phone systems, to ensure smooth operations.
- Perform other related duties as assigned by management

**Experience**:

- Experience with PARS/ PAPS would be an asset.
- Previous experience working as a dispatcher or in a similar role in the transportation industry is preferred
- Knowledge of fleet management practices and procedures.
- Strong data entry skills with attention to detail.
- Excellent communication skills, both verbal and written
- Ability to multitask and prioritize tasks in a fast-paced environment.
